    Little boy who lost his foot at 18 months now models for Primark, Amazon and Schuh

    A little boy who lost his foot at 18 months has become a model and now he travels the world posing for famous brands including Primark, Amazon and Schuh. Arlo Tate, nine, was diagnosed with fibular hemimelia - a missing fibula - at birth. An "abnormality" was picked up at his 20-week scan - but doctors were unsure what his condition was at the time.     Photos of 2022 southern China floods passed off online as 2024 deluge

    Severe floods in southern China's Guangdong province claimed the lives of four people and forced the evacuation of more than 100,000 in April 2024, however, online posts have shared old photos of record flooding there in 2022. The earlier crisis left some Chinese towns submerged by floodwaters and forced hundreds of thousands of people to evacuate.
